Pathfinder PAG80-1V Men's

Product Description: Pathfinder PAG80-1V Men's

Tough Solar Power. Digital Compass. Altimeter Barmeter Thermometer. 100 Meter Water Resistance. Auto EL Backlight Alarm. 1/100 Second Stopwatch. Countdown Timer.

Product Specification: Pathfinder PAG80-1V Men's

Features: Alarm, Water Resistant
Movement: Quartz Movement
Display: Digital Display

    Almost everything I wanted,

    By oaktree  May 18, 2008

    Pros: 5 alarm clocks, compass, altimeter, barometer, thermometer, and Solar Power

    Cons: light button hard to press

    I bought the Casio Sport Pathfinder Triple Sensor Solar Power from Sam's Club for about $162.84. It has all the features I wanted. The only complaint I have about this particular model is that the light button is hard to press, especially at nigh...t when you need it. And when you press a button after you press the light button on the watch, it automatically turns light off. Kinda sucks when you are trying to do multiple functions during limited visibility. All the other features work well including the full auto el. The five alarms is a great bonus! Read more Less
